Title :
Research on integral error calibrating system of high-voltage electric energy measurement device

Abstract :
To the question that there is no accuracy grade to the existed HV energy measuring system, a design scheme to calibrate the integer error of HV energy measuring device is provided in this paper. The hardware of the calibrating system, including test power source, signal source, power benchmark system, power source measuring and regulating circuit, has been introduced in detail. The function of the monitoring and operating software is also discussed in the paper.
